WHY NOWADAYS EVERYBODY USE CLOUD BASED SOFTWARE ?
WHY
NOWADAYS EVERYBODY USE CLOUD BASED SOFTWARE ?
The widespread adoption of cloud-based software
today can be attributed to several key factors that offer substantial benefits
over traditional on-premise software solutions. Here are the main reasons :
·
Accessibility
and Mobility:
Anywhere, Anytime
Access: Cloud-based software can be accessed from any location with an internet
connection, allowing for greater flexibility and remote work capabilities.
Device Agnosticism:
Users can access cloud services from various devices, including desktops,
laptops, tablets, and smart phones.
·
Cost
Efficiency:
Lower Upfront Costs:
Cloud services typically operate on a subscription or pay-as-you-go model,
reducing the need for significant initial investments in hardware and software.
Reduced Maintenance and
Operational Costs: Cloud providers handle infrastructure maintenance, updates,
and security, alleviating these burdens from the user.
·
Scalability
and Flexibility:
Easy Scaling:
Businesses can easily scale their usage up or down based on their needs without
the need for significant hardware changes.
Flexible Resources:
Cloud infrastructure can dynamically allocate resources, ensuring optimal
performance during varying workloads.
·
Collaboration
and Integration:
Enhanced Collaboration:
Cloud-based tools often include features that facilitate real-time
collaboration among users, regardless of their geographical locations.
Integration
Capabilities: Many cloud services can seamlessly integrate with other software
and platforms, improving workflow and data management.
·
Security
and Compliance:
Advanced Security
Measures: Reputable cloud providers invest heavily in security measures to
protect data, including encryption, access controls, and regular security
updates.
Compliance: Many cloud
providers offer compliance with various industry standards and regulations,
which can be crucial for businesses in regulated industries.
·
Disaster
Recovery and Backup:
Data Redundancy: Cloud
services often include automated backups and data redundancy, which helps in
quick recovery from hardware failures or other disasters.
Business Continuity:
Cloud solutions can ensure business continuity by providing access to
applications and data even during local disruptions.
·
Innovation
and Updates:
Continuous Improvement:
Cloud providers regularly update their software with new features and
improvements, providing users with access to the latest technologies without
needing manual upgrades.
Early Adoption of
Emerging Technologies: Cloud platforms often adopt and integrate emerging
technologies, such as AI and machine learning, providing users with
cutting-edge tools.
·
Environmental
Considerations:
Energy Efficiency:
Cloud data centers are typically more energy-efficient compared to traditional
on-premise setups, contributing to reduced carbon footprints for organizations.
These benefits
collectively make cloud-based software an attractive option for businesses and
individuals, driving the widespread shift towards cloud computing in various
sectors.
